In a surprising twist that merges nostalgia with contemporary trends, Jessie Cave, best known as Lavender Brown from the Harry Potter film series, has ventured into the world of OnlyFans, but with a decidedly niche twist. Instead of showcasing the usual risqué content often associated with the platform, Cave is focusing her efforts on hair-related content — yes, you read that right. This bold move is not just about cashing in on her fame; it’s a liberating act of self-empowerment aimed at alleviating her financial burdens.
In a candid reveal during her podcast, “Before We Break Up Again,” Cave declared her intention to cater to those with a fascination for hair, describing her content as having a “slutty Mormon” vibe. The 37-year-old actress, who is a mother to four young children, aims to turn the comments she receives about her hair into a creative outlet. “I just thought, ‘F–k it, I’m going to do something that is very niche,’” she shared, showcasing her willingness to embrace the unconventional.
While many celebrities have turned to OnlyFans for its lucrative potential, Cave’s approach stands out. She plans to upload content almost daily, promising that her offerings will be far from explicit, as she clearly states in her bio: “Will not do explicit sexual content. Might be in my underwear.” This unique angle not only highlights her creativity but also challenges societal expectations of what female empowerment can look like in today’s digital landscape.
Moreover, Cave’s decision resonates with a growing trend among public figures choosing OnlyFans as a platform for personal expression rather than purely sexual content. Other stars like Denise Richards have also embraced the platform, albeit with varying degrees of controversy. Richards joined OnlyFans after her daughter faced backlash for creating her account, underscoring the generational shift in attitudes toward adult content.
As Cave embarks on this new venture, she hopes to transform her financial situation and, perhaps more importantly, redefine her identity beyond the “prim actress” label. “This is very much a way of me saying, ‘Okay, I’m doing something that is not normal and a bit kinky. And why not?’” she mused, embodying a spirit of bold self-acceptance that many can admire.
